Overview

Join to apply for the Service Engineer – Sprinklers role at JLL.

You will be responsible for PPM and servicing on sprinkler systems.

This is a great opportunity for an individual interested in entering or returning to the sprinkler industry as a Service Engineer.

What You Will Be Doing

  • Responsible for PPM and small works projects across a few buildings
  • Servicing all types of valve sets
  • Carrying out 5 point flow tests on fire pumps
  • Conducting general service checks

What We Will Need From You

  • Experience in servicing all types of the following valve sets: Wet, dry, alternate, deluge and pre-Action (essential)
  • Experience of carrying out 5-point flow tests on sprinkler fire pumps and general service checks (essential)
  • Experience of Plumbing / Piping Knowledge & fault finding on sprinkler systems (essential)
  • Must have a full UK driving license able to cover a regional role (essential)
  • Sprinkler Installation Level 2 qualified (desirable)
  • Previous experience gained within Commercial / Industrial buildings environment (desirable)
  • Experience in small works install (desirable)
  • Experience and understanding of electronic reporting (desirable)

What You Can Expect In Return

  • Competitive & negotiable Salary Range
  • 25 days holiday + bank holidays
  • Company pension scheme
  • Company Van
  • Mobile phone and tablet
